Engelhard Corporation of New Jersey, and the US Department of Agriculture (WO
98/38848) want to make photosynthesis more efficient, so that crops can produce
more carbohydrates from carbon dioxide and water in poor light. A finely
powdered inert material, such as kaolin, quartz or chalk is mixed with a wetting
agent and water to form a slurry. This is then sprayed on the crop along with a
small amount of adhesive. The fine particles let some light through and bounce
the rest between the leaves, giving an increase in illumination. When the spray
was tested on apple trees, it gave more higher quality fruit.
